Skip to content

Instantly share code, notes, and snippets.

@terriyu
Last active December 21, 2015 01:39
Show Gist options
  • Save terriyu/6229473 to your computer and use it in GitHub Desktop.
Save terriyu/6229473 to your computer and use it in GitHub Desktop.
When I run the Ceilometer unit tests, the tests for Nova notifier fail. The relevant traceback from running the Ceilometer unit tests: Traceback (most recent call last): File "/opt/stack/ceilometer/.tox/py27/local/lib/python2.7/site-packages/mock.py", line 1201, in patched return func(*args, **keywargs) File "/opt/stack/ceilometer/nova_tests/tes…
$ cd /opt/stack/ceilometer
$ tox -e py27
GLOB sdist-make: /opt/stack/ceilometer/setup.py
py27 inst-nodeps: /opt/stack/ceilometer/.tox/dist/ceilometer-2013.2.a378.g90ad86c.zip
py27 runtests: commands[0] | bash -x /opt/stack/ceilometer/run-tests.sh
WARNING:test command found but not installed in testenv
cmd: /bin/bash
env: /opt/stack/ceilometer/.tox/py27
Maybe forgot to specify a dependency?
+ set -e
+ '[' '' = --coverage ']'
+ '[' '!' '' ']'
+ bash tools/init_testr_if_needed.sh
+ python setup.py testr --slowest '--testr-args=--concurrency=1 --here=nova_tests '
running testr
running=${PYTHON:-python} -m subunit.run discover -t ./nova_tests ./nova_tests
======================================================================
FAIL: test_notifier.TestNovaNotifier.test_correct_gatherer
tags: worker-0
----------------------------------------------------------------------
pythonlogging:'': {{{Loading compute driver 'nova.virt.fake.FakeDriver'}}}
Traceback (most recent call last):
File "/opt/stack/ceilometer/.tox/py27/local/lib/python2.7/site-packages/mock.py", line 1201, in patched
return func(*args, **keywargs)
File "/opt/stack/ceilometer/nova_tests/test_notifier.py", line 153, in setUp
notifier_api.add_driver(self)
AttributeError: 'module' object has no attribute 'add_driver'
======================================================================
FAIL: test_notifier.TestNovaNotifier.test_correct_instance
tags: worker-0
----------------------------------------------------------------------
pythonlogging:'': {{{Loading compute driver 'nova.virt.fake.FakeDriver'}}}
Traceback (most recent call last):
File "/opt/stack/ceilometer/.tox/py27/local/lib/python2.7/site-packages/mock.py", line 1201, in patched
return func(*args, **keywargs)
File "/opt/stack/ceilometer/nova_tests/test_notifier.py", line 153, in setUp
notifier_api.add_driver(self)
AttributeError: 'module' object has no attribute 'add_driver'
======================================================================
FAIL: test_notifier.TestNovaNotifier.test_pollster_called
tags: worker-0
----------------------------------------------------------------------
pythonlogging:'': {{{Loading compute driver 'nova.virt.fake.FakeDriver'}}}
Traceback (most recent call last):
File "/opt/stack/ceilometer/.tox/py27/local/lib/python2.7/site-packages/mock.py", line 1201, in patched
return func(*args, **keywargs)
File "/opt/stack/ceilometer/nova_tests/test_notifier.py", line 153, in setUp
notifier_api.add_driver(self)
AttributeError: 'module' object has no attribute 'add_driver'
======================================================================
FAIL: test_notifier.TestNovaNotifier.test_samples
tags: worker-0
----------------------------------------------------------------------
pythonlogging:'': {{{Loading compute driver 'nova.virt.fake.FakeDriver'}}}
Traceback (most recent call last):
File "/opt/stack/ceilometer/.tox/py27/local/lib/python2.7/site-packages/mock.py", line 1201, in patched
return func(*args, **keywargs)
File "/opt/stack/ceilometer/nova_tests/test_notifier.py", line 153, in setUp
notifier_api.add_driver(self)
AttributeError: 'module' object has no attribute 'add_driver'
======================================================================
FAIL: process-returncode
tags: worker-0
----------------------------------------------------------------------
Binary content:
traceback (test/plain; charset="utf8")
Ran 9 (+4) tests in 0.392s (-0.058s)
FAILED (id=3, failures=5)
error: testr failed (1)
ERROR: InvocationError: '/bin/bash -x /opt/stack/ceilometer/run-tests.sh'
py27 runtests: commands[1] | /opt/stack/ceilometer/tools/config/check_uptodate.sh
___________________________________ summary ____________________________________
ERROR: py27: commands failed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ment